Understanding Indoor Air Quality Concerns

Air purifiers play a pivotal role in enhancing indoor air quality (IAQ), addressing concerns that often go unnoticed yet significantly impact our health and well-being. Indoor environments can be up to five times more polluted than outdoor air due to various sources of contamination, including volatile organic compounds (VOCs) from furniture and cleaning products, pet dander, dust mites, mold spores, and even human activities like cooking and smoking. These pollutants contribute to a range of health issues, from respiratory problems and allergies to cardiovascular disease and cognitive impairment.
Understanding these IAQ concerns is crucial because many people spend up to 90% of their time indoors—in homes, schools, offices, or public spaces. Traditional methods like opening windows and using air fresheners often fall short in effectively tackling these complex issues. This is where air purifiers step in as powerful allies. They actively remove airborne contaminants by filtering out particles and gases, creating a cleaner, healthier living space.
For instance, HEPA (High-Efficiency Particulate Air) filters, commonly found in high-quality air purifiers, can trap at least 99.97% of particles as small as 0.3 microns—a level that includes most common allergens and pollutants. Additionally, some advanced models incorporate carbon filters to target odors and gases, ensuring a multifaceted approach to IAQ improvement. By employing these technologies, air purifiers offer a practical solution for individuals seeking to reduce exposure to these invisible yet harmful elements.

Types of Air Purifier Technologies Explained

Air purifiers are designed to significantly improve indoor air quality by removing pollutants like dust, allergens, smoke, and odors. They work by using various technologies to filter or clean the air as it circulates through the unit. Understanding these different technologies is crucial when choosing an air purifier to ensure you're investing in one that best suits your needs.
There are primarily three types of air purifier technologies: HEPA filters, carbon (or activated carbon) filters, and UV-C light filtration. HEPA filters are highly effective at trapping microscopic particles like dust, pollen, and pet dander as they use a complex network of fibers to capture pollutants. Carbon filters, on the other hand, are particularly good at removing odors, volatile organic compounds (VOCs), and even some gases due to their porous structure that absorbs substances. UV-C light filtration is known for its ability to kill bacteria, viruses, and mold spores by damaging their DNA.
Each technology has its strengths and weaknesses, making certain options more suitable for specific scenarios. For example, HEPA filters are ideal for individuals with allergies or asthma who need a powerful allergen reducer, while carbon filters can be beneficial in areas with high humidity levels where musty odors are a concern. A combination of these technologies is often the best approach to tackle multiple types of pollutants effectively.

Choosing the Right Air Purifier for Your Space
The key to a fresher, cleaner indoor environment lies in selecting an air purifier tailored to your space's unique needs. Not all purifiers are created equal; their effectiveness depends on factors like room size, air quality issues, and energy efficiency. For instance, HEPA filters, known for trapping 99.7% of particles as small as 0.3 microns, excel in tackling allergens and dust but may require more frequent replacement. On the other hand, activated carbon filters are adept at removing odors and volatile organic compounds (VOCs) but alone might not capture smaller particles.
When choosing, consider your space's size and layout. For larger rooms or open-concept areas, opt for purifiers with higher air exchange rates (AER), ensuring efficient filtration of all zones. Smaller spaces can often be adequately served by models with lower AERs. Additionally, smart features like automatic sensors and remote control compatibility offer convenience, adjusting settings based on real-time air quality data.
Energy efficiency is another vital aspect. Look for Energy Star-rated purifiers that not only reduce energy costs but also minimize environmental impact. Regular maintenance, including filter changes according to manufacturer recommendations, is crucial for optimal performance. By carefully considering these factors, you can select an air purifier that effectively addresses your specific indoor air quality concerns.
Maintenance and Efficiency: Keeping Up with Air Purifiers

Maintaining an air purifier is key to keeping your indoor spaces as fresh and clean as possible. These devices work hard to filter out pollutants and allergens, but they require regular care to maintain their efficiency. Simply changing filters at the recommended intervals can significantly impact air quality. Most modern air purifiers have indicator lights or sensors that signal when a replacement filter is needed. Following manufacturer guidelines for filter replacements ensures optimal performance.
Over time, other components within the purifier may also need attention. Pre-filters, for instance, catch larger particles and protect the main filter. Regular cleaning or replacement of these pre-filters prevents them from becoming clogged and reducing overall efficiency. Some purifiers have washable filters, which can be a cost-effective and eco-friendly option. It's important to understand your specific purifier's requirements, as maintenance needs can vary between models.
Efficiency isn't just about filter changes. Regular cleaning of the purifier's exterior and air pathways can prevent dust buildup that could affect performance. Many purifiers have easily removable parts for deep cleaning. Maintaining these devices is an investment in your health—a well-maintained air purifier ensures cleaner, healthier air to breathe.
